Delving into the Essence of Pranayama
Derived from Sanskrit, “Prana” signifies life force, while “Ayama” denotes control or extension. The Vedas, ancient Indian scriptures, highlight the connection between breath and consciousness, establishing breath as the essence of life itself. Over time, diverse Pranayama techniques have emerged, each offering unique advantages:
- Anulom Vilom (Alternate Nostril Breathing): This technique helps balance the flow of energy throughout the body’s subtle channels. It promotes harmony between the left and right hemispheres of the brain, fostering emotional equilibrium.
- Kapalabhati (Skull Shining Breath): Known for its invigorating and detoxifying effects, Kapalabhati clears the respiratory system and energizes the mind. It helps dispel mental fog and promotes clarity.
- Bhramari (Bee Breath): Bhramari utilizes humming sounds to soothe the nervous system and calm the mind. Its gentle vibrations create a sense of deep relaxation and inner peace.
Pranayama works by harmonizing the ‘nadis’, the subtle energy pathways within the body. This balance facilitates spiritual awakening and reinforces the profound link between breath and consciousness—a central theme in Indian philosophy.

The Profound Spiritual Significance of Pranayama
Pranayama serves as a bridge between our physical existence and the spiritual realm, creating a pathway for deeper meditation and expanded states of consciousness. The revered Patanjali’s Yoga Sutras emphasize Pranayama as a key to controlling the mind’s wanderings and attaining ‘Samadhi,’ the ultimate state of spiritual enlightenment.
A fascinating aspect of Pranayama is the concept of ‘Kundalini awakening.’ This transformative process involves the rising of dormant energy through the chakras, leading to heightened awareness and spiritual insight. Countless spiritual seekers share inspiring stories of personal transformation through consistent Pranayama practice, describing experiences of profound inner peace, contentment, and a clearer understanding of life’s purpose.
By enhancing mental clarity and emotional stability, Pranayama cultivates fertile ground for spiritual blossoming. Scientific studies reveal that breath control influences brainwave patterns, inducing relaxation and heightened awareness. The practice nurtures mindfulness by anchoring our attention to the present moment. This present-moment awareness is foundational to spiritual growth.

Integrating Pranayama into Your Daily Life
To seamlessly integrate Pranayama into your daily routine, begin by creating a peaceful and inviting space for your practice. A quiet, clutter-free environment enhances focus and allows you to fully immerse yourself in the experience. Start with simple techniques like deep, conscious breathing and gradually progress to more advanced practices as you gain comfort and confidence.
Consistency is key to reaping the full benefits of Pranayama. Set clear intentions before each session to maximize its impact. Common hurdles include maintaining focus and managing distractions. Establish a regular practice schedule and consider combining Pranayama with meditation for a holistic spiritual experience.
